About this position

Job Description

Job Description

This is a year-round, full-time career opportunity with benefits in the Michigan's Adventure Maintenance Department.

The ideal candidate will be a team orientated Construction and Maintenance Electrician with experience in a diverse environment. The successful candidate will have proven skills troubleshooting and will have the ability to problem solve and follow the guidelines of a detailed preventative maintenance program.

A "hands-on" individual who is responsible for the maintenance and installation of the electrical needs across the theme park property.

Responsibilities:

  • Oversee and execute daily completion of preventative maintenance as outlined
  • Organize and maintain proper documentation
  • Report issues to Area Manager and Manager as required
  • Assist with identification of potential problems and suggest modifications, upgrades and improvements to Foreperson on a timely basis
  • Oversee and execute major overhauls, modifications and alterations
  • Ensure the safe operation of each work area and each work project.
  • Assist with general cleaning, inspection and reassembling equipment as needed
  • Assist and provide guidance to seasonal associates as assigned

Qualifications:

  • Minimum five (5) years of experience as a licensed technician in a diverse environment or an apprentice with prior experience in a Rides environment
  • Strong written and oral communication skills
  • Valid Michigan driver's license
  • Preferred Experience with Rockwell software, such as RS500, RS5000, Studio 5000
  • Preferred Experience with Allen-Bradley PLC controllers such as Control Logix and SLC500
  • Ability to work from manuals and blueprints is essential
  • Ability to work shifts weekends and holidays as required
  • Ownership of tools and safety boots
  • Ability to work outdoors in all types of weather conditions
  • Required to meet the physical demands of the job including weights of up to 50 lbs, heights of 150 feet, frequent standing, walking, twisting, reaching, bending, crawling and ability to work with ladders
